Chicago, Illinois, 1903 Pages 633-634 HON. H. C. GORDON, mayor of Huntington, who is now serving his second term as the highest municipal officer, is senior member of the fire insurance firm of Gordon, Peyton & Perkinson, of that city. He was born on a farm near Vevay, Indiana. His father, George Gordon, a farmer in that locality, died about 1893, but his mother resides in Jefferson County, in that State. Several brothers reside in Indiana, and one brother, who is now a farmer on East River, West Virginia, was formerly engaged in business in Huntington. Mayor Gordon was reared on his father's farm and then went to Cincinnati, Ohio, and was employed by the firm of Gordon & Rouse, which was succeeded by the firm of H. Gordon, our subject's brother. In July, 1883, this lumber and mill business was removed to Huntington, and for the following 12 years our subject was one of the concern's employees. In 1895 he leased the mill and conducted the business for two years, employing some 60 men, when the mill was then moved to Ironton, Ohio. In 1897 he engaged in a coal and lumber business, with office at the corner of 16th street and 3rd avenue; the firm handles manufactured pine, cypress, Washington cedar lumber and Kanawha River coal. For the past two years he has been also engaged in a fire insurance business with Messrs. Peyton and Perkinson, with offices at No. 438 9th street. Mr. Gordon is public spirited and has proved his business ability not only in capably managing large business interests of his own, but also in directing the affairs of the city to the satisfaction of all parties. His ability, fairness, his judgment and care for the city's needs have won him many friends. Mayor Gordon married a Miss Bagley of Kentucky, and they reside in spacious apartments at the Adelphi Hotel. Mr. Gordon owns several fine residence properties and is one of the city's moneyed men. Fraternally he is connected with the Masons, the Odd Fellows, the Elks and the Modem Woodmen of America. Both he and his wife belong to the Methodist Church. ------------------------------------------------------------------- DEATH CERTIFICATE, Cabell County WV, #113 FULL-NAME: Hiram C.
